Setting Sail from Dubrovnik’s Lapadska Obala
Starting at Lapadska Obala Pier, this tour offers a convenient and scenic departure point. The meeting is straightforward—just your group and the skipper—which sets the tone for a relaxed, personalized experience. From the outset, you’ll appreciate the small boat size—a cozy 21-foot speed boat—that ensures intimacy and stability on the water.
The Itinerary: A Perfect Sunset Journey
The main event is the sunset itself—a magnificent display of colors that play across the sky as the day comes to an end. The boat heads toward the Grebeni Lighthouse, positioned on a reef protecting the bay of Lapad. This spot is a highlight because it offers a clear, unobstructed view of the horizon, perfect for snapping photos or just soaking in the moment.
During the sail, the skipper shares intriguing stories about Dubrovnik’s background, adding depth to the scenic views. These tales, combined with the sound of gentle waves and the seabirds overhead, create a calming atmosphere. The only real “noise” you’ll hear is the seagulls, which adds a natural soundtrack rather than a distraction.
The Views: Coastline, Islands, and Sunset
The scenery along Dubrovnik’s coast is stunning—craggy cliffs, lush green islands, and the historic Old Town from afar. As you drift past the Elaphite Islands, the landscape feels almost cinematic. Many reviews mention how breathtaking the sunset colors are, with vibrant pinks, oranges, and purples reflecting on the water.
The Drinks and Snacks: A Taste of Local Flavor
Included are snacks, drinks—including local wine, beers, water, and soft drinks—and fuel. The local wine is a highlight, adding a taste of Croatia to the experience. Sipping wine while watching the sunset over Dubrovnik’s coast is a moment many travelers say they’ll never forget.

The Downsides and Practicalities
The main consideration is that the tour is weather-dependent—if rain or strong wind arrive, the experience could be canceled or rescheduled, as noted in the policy. Plus, this tour doesn’t include hotel pickup, so you’ll need to arrange your own transportation to the meeting point. For those staying outside the central areas or with mobility issues, this might require some planning.

The Practical Side

Booking is straightforward, with mobile tickets making planning easy. The meeting point at Lapadska Obala is accessible, and the tour runs at 6:00 pm, aligning with sunset times. Since the duration is around two hours, it fits well into an evening after a day of exploring Dubrovnik’s sights or relaxing at your accommodation.
The price of $327.31 per group offers good value for an intimate, fully private experience. It includes all fees and taxes, plus snacks, drinks, and fuel, which means no hidden costs. Remember, this is a private activity, so it’s just your group—ideal for creating personal memories.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is the tour suitable for children or pets?
Yes, the tour allows service animals, and generally most travelers can participate. However, since it’s a private tour, it’s best to confirm specific needs when booking.
Does the tour include hotel pickup?
No, the tour does not include hotel pickup or drop-off. Participants need to arrange their own transportation to the meeting point at Lapadska Obala Pier.
What should I bring?
Bring you comfortable clothes suitable for the weather, a camera, and perhaps a light jacket for the evening breeze. Sunscreen may be useful if you’re starting earlier in the day.
Can I cancel if the weather is bad?
Yes, cancellations are free up to 24 hours in advance. If weather conditions shift unexpectedly, the tour may be canceled, and you’ll be offered a different date or a full refund.
How many people can join?
Up to 6 people per group, making it ideal for small, private experiences.
What time does the tour start?
The tour begins at 6:00 pm, timed for the sunset, so check the local sunset time during your visit.
Is this tour available year-round?
The description doesn’t specify seasonal restrictions, but since good weather is necessary, it’s best enjoyed in late spring through early autumn.
